Millerton Lake State Park is my home lake--about 20 min N. of Fresno. Have been boating there for 35 years. It's located on the border of Fresno and Madera counties. There are some pretty decent camp grounds--modern restrooms/showers, some camp sites right at water when the lake is full, with 2-3 lane ramp right there--on the Madera side, but just day use on the Fresno side. Temp is central valley HOT--usually cools down at night, but the water temp is great. Water is used for irrigation, so lake level goes down after July 1. Currently it is at the bottom of the first (of four) launch ramp. Table Mountain Casino is located just a mile or so east of the Fresno entrance. Little town of Friant, at the base of the dam has a couple of decent restaurants and gas just a few cents higher than in Fresno. Don't know the price of gas at the marina. Most of the boating pressure is on weekends--usually no boats on weekday mornings before noon or so.

Yes, Shaver Lake is about 1 hour up the road from Millerton. It's at 5500 ft elevation which means the air is clear and beautiful--80s during the day, 60 at night, but you'll lose about 15% of your performance. Smaller than Millerton, but it usually stays full until Sept/Oct. Good camping at Edison campground, but make a reservation.
